These are the best dumplings in the city. I’m convinced. They are known for their soup dumplings, so well known that there is a small freezer at the front with soup dumplings for sale. I promise you, you won’t find a variety of soup dumplings like this anywhere else.
The wait is long at every time of day, so if you plan to eat there, make sure you check in there first to get your name on the list, do some adventuring through Chinatown and then come back for your meal.
The service is also very attentive. They have a lot of people there so it’s not the place to linger over a meal, but the food is incredible, the servers are very professional, and the atmosphere is also very good.
Also, beware they do not validate parking at the lot across the street. I recommend taking the public transit if possible because parking is rough there.

Guys, come on. This is clearly a tourist trap. First thing I see when I go inside is that all the people eating there INCLUDING the workers are American. The dumplings were decent and chasing good but not good enough. Let's talk about the price first. You pay $21 for 12 dumplings. That is $1.76 per bite. The dumplings had a lot of juice. Unfortunately, when a dumpling spot messes up their dough and under-cooks it, it's over. The dough either didn't have enough water or it was under-cooked. It wasn't that under-cooked but you could taste the dryness of the dough. The more you eat, the more you were reminded of the freezer isle at Costco. Another problem was the inconsistent starch at the bottom. This is a technique you use to give the bottom another layer that tastes light and crisp. Only some pieces had the starch at the bottom. If you want to serve dumplings with starch, you absolutely cannot put those dumplings in little individual small pockets in the takeout box. It does not fit. You can get 12 dumplings for under 10$ at many locations. I can't see why you would ever come here. The pork was also some kind of special pork. Nothing special about it at all.

I had this place bookmarked last year for my last trip to Chicago, but I didn’t end up getting around to eating there because my flight was delayed the first day. This time, since I had a lot of time to kill between the end of my conference until my flight, I decided to stop for a quick solo lunch. I came in around 12pm on a Monday afternoon and I was able to snag a table. By the time I left around 12:45pm, there were several people waiting for tables, so it definitely gets busy around lunch time.
I had the cucumbers in special sauce and an order of their pork and cabbage dumplings pan fried. Both were excellent. The dumplings were so juicy! They’re 12 to an order, but they’re about half the size of typical dumplings, so you’re really eating maybe 6 full sized dumplings. I demolished the entire order myself.
Service was very quick and very nice. Would 10/10 come back, but maybe with friends next time so I can get more dumplings to try!
